   We have gzipped text files in Google Cloud Storage that have the following 
metadata headers set:
   
   ```
   
   Content-Encoding: gzip
   Content-Type: application/octet-stream
   
   ```
   
   
   Trying to read these with apache_beam.io.ReadFromText yields the following 
error:
   
   ```
   
   ERROR:root:Exception while fetching 341565 bytes from position 0 of 
gs://...-c72fa25a-5d8a-4801-a0b4-54b58c4723ce.gz:
   Cannot have start index greater than total size

   After removing the Content-Encoding header the read works fine.
